Scott has been an avid fly fisherman in the Kings River and the surrounding waters of Sequoia National Forest for more than two decades. As a professional guide, he focuses on fly fishing the Kings River, bringing unparalleled local expertise to every trip. Scott is a graduate of the Clearwater Guide School in Northern California and currently lives and works full-time at Hume Lake Christian Camps. The Kings River, his favorite freestone river, is teeming with Rainbow and Brown Trout, and the stunning views at every turn make the experience even more special.

The ideal times for fishing on the river are summer and fall, with much of winter also available on the lower stretches. By summer, the high spring flows have diminished, water levels stabilize for easier wading, and fish activity increases. If the Lower Kings River becomes too warm during summer, you can visit the Upper Kings, where temperatures are generally cooler and more comfortable.
